Transaction 43d867d52265984a733807bdd2458e3db202fae27b7ed9d41efca5440d4b0c71
1 Input
1 Output
-
43d867d52265984a733807bdd2458e3db202fae27b7ed9d41efca5440d4b0c71:0
- value
- 52250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f23eb8ccb637fc981d09b7e04a57f686f17b53e8 OP_EQUAL
- address
- 3PmtaxZz5ie7pk2xP4cr2P163vJAPhgh9M